Health Anxiety
Health anxiety can create constant worry, body checking, and fear around illness or physical symptoms. Rather than dismissing your fears, we work compassionately to understand what may sit beneath them, reducing overwhelm and helping you feel more secure and balanced.
What Health Anxiety Looks Like
Health anxiety might include:
- Constant worry about having a serious illness
- Frequent body checking and monitoring for symptoms
- Seeking reassurance from doctors or loved ones repeatedly
- Difficulty believing reassurance, even from medical professionals
- Researching symptoms online and catastrophizing
- Avoidance of medical appointments due to anxiety
- Physical symptoms triggered or worsened by anxiety itself
The Anxiety-Symptom Cycle
Often with health anxiety, worry itself creates physical symptoms—tension, heart palpitations, dizziness—which then fuels more worry. Understanding this cycle is key to breaking it.
Compassionate Support
Rather than dismissing your concerns, we work to:
- Understand what fears lie underneath the worry about illness
- Reduce body checking and reassurance-seeking behaviors
- Learn to tolerate uncertainty about your health
- Develop ways to manage anxiety that don't feed the cycle
- Build genuine confidence in your ability to cope
